Raising a child is an wonderful journey filled with joy and challenges. Individual child develops at their own pace, exhibiting unique talents and gifts. As parents, we have the responsibility to nurture our children's growth, providing them with the tools and support they need to flourish.
Focusing on healthy development involves creating a supportive environment that fosters physical, cognitive, emotional, and social well-being.
Here are some key aspects to consider:
* **Physical Health:** Encourage physical activity. Provide nutritious meals and avoid sugary drinks and processed foods.
* **Cognitive Development:** Read to your child frequently, engage in thought-provoking games, and stimulate their curiosity through exploration.
* **Emotional Well-being:** Help your child manage their emotions in a healthy way. Provide unconditional love and create a safe space for them to share their concerns.
* **Social Skills:** Encourage socialization with other children. Teach your child cooperation and how to resolve conflicts.
Remember, every child is different. Be patient, understanding, and appreciate their unique growth. By providing a nurturing and supportive environment, you can help your child unlock their full potential.

The Power of Play: Nurturing Creativity and Collaborative Skills in Children
Play isn't just enjoyable for kids; it's a fundamental aspect of their development. Through play, children investigate the world around them, strengthening essential skills. From role-playing real-life situations to creating imaginative worlds, play ignites their curiosity and nurtures their relationship development.
Playing jointly encourages children to communicate, manage disagreements, and wait their turn. These opportunities help them develop crucial interpersonal competencies that will benefit them throughout their lives.
- Provide children with a variety of play materials to ignite their imaginations.
- Encourage imaginative and open-ended play, allowing them to design their own games and stories.
- Join your child's play, demonstrating active interest and participation.
From Tantrums to Triumph: Effective Strategies for Managing Challenging Behaviors
Parenting can sometimes feel like navigating a minefield of difficult behaviors. Kids are constantly learning and growing, but that process doesn't always go smoothly. When meltdowns occur, it's important to remember that these outbursts often stem from discomfort. Instead of reacting with anger or punishment, try implementing strategies that teach your child how to deal with their emotions effectively.
Initiate by creating a calm and predictable environment. Create clear expectations and routines, and provide consistent reinforcement when your child behaves well.
When challenging behavior does arise, stay calm and patient. Avoid screaming, as this can only escalate the situation. Instead, try to grasp the root of the problem.
Sometimes, a simple embrace can work wonders in calming a child down. Other times, you may need to take away them from the environment temporarily to give them time to regulate.
Remember that managing challenging behaviors is a journey, not a destination. It takes time, patience, and consistency to help your child learn new coping skills. By staying encouraging, you can empower your child to overcome their challenges and reach true triumph.
